Mailer Daemon failure notice on incoming emails that dont fail.

Mailer Daemon Failure notice for emails that don't fail

When incoming emails are sent to me, or my outgoing emails responded to at my sbcglobal.net email address, I receive the email, but the sender receives a Mailer-Daemon failure email notice. Below is the text of the failure email:

(Please note the email it is saying is "unavailable" is nowhere close to resembling my email address.)

Sorry, we were unable to deliver your message to the following address. 

<[email scrubbed]>
550: Requested action not taken: mailbox unavailable.

How can I fix the issue?

To fix this, simply check to see if there is an auto-forward rule set up for his sbcglobal.net address.

  • The solution is to go to mailbox ( currently.com) settings.
  • In the upper right-hand corner, select the Gear, and choose More Settings.
  • On the Settings menu, in the left-hand column, select Mailboxes.
  • Check the Forwarding field and remove it if it is there.

Give it a shot and let us know if the problem persists.
